We went to the gaurage and up to the shops. There are three shops, one for tatooing, one for piercing and one for where you purchase the jewelry. While I was buying the stud for my nose (which set me back $72, that incluedes the piercing) I was talking non-stop about being nervous. Luckily the girl working there was so incredibly nice. She told me about her first nose piercing. Then we talked about which side to put it on and why. I decided with the left because I'm left handed. Talking to her allowed me to calm down a ton, and follow through.

Next I went across the hall to the actual piercing place to meet Erin. I was so relieved that Erin was so nice ( and she had rockin Tatoos- which I definetly envy!). They are really cool about bringing in a friend for suport i recommend only bringing one or two tops because the rooms are really small, so my friend came in with me. Then she (erin) reassured me that she did about 10 nose piercing a day and they're a cinch. She cleaned out my nose with Iodine and showed me where she thought the nose ring would look good. I thought it would look better a little further down and she was completely cool about it. Then she had me close my eyes and in less then a minute the stud was in. It did not even bleed, Erin joked with me saying i must be a vampire because most of the time people bleed a little.

I was so shocked how fast it was too, and painless (the whole ordeal of buying the jewelry, talking to the friendly employees, filling out paper work and getting it pierced took a total of a half hour and that includes waiting in the waiting area!). Honestly my 3rd earring holes hurt more. With the exception of a little bit of throbing for an hour or so after the piercing was painless. It hurts more to stretch your ears then it is to get your nose pierced, not to mention how cute it looks! I love it.
